Fix bug where make menuconfig doesn't initialize the default locale, which causes ncurses menu borders to be displayed incorrectly (lqqqqk) in UTF-8 terminals that don't support VT100 ACS by default, such as PuTTY.

### 1. **Code Change Analysis** The commit adds just 2 lines of code: - `setlocale(LC_ALL, "");` in the main() function before init_dialog() - `#include <locale.h>` header (alphabetically ordered)
This is placed at scripts/kconfig/mconf.c:932, immediately after signal handler setup and before any ncurses initialization.
### 2. **Bug Impact Assessment** - **Scope**: Affects `make menuconfig` display in UTF-8 terminals (PuTTY, and others that don't support VT100 ACS by default) - **Symptom**: Menu borders appear as "lqqqqk" instead of proper box- drawing characters - **User Impact**: Degrades usability for kernel developers/users configuring kernels in affected terminals - **Severity**: Non-critical but user-visible cosmetic/usability issue
### 3. **Risk Analysis** **Extremely Low Risk:** - This is build-time tooling only - does NOT affect kernel runtime behavior - Standard ncurses programming pattern (documented in ncurses best practices) - No dependencies on other kernel subsystems - setlocale() is a standard POSIX C library function with well-defined behavior - Change is isolated to menuconfig tool's main() function
